Steer clear of those chocolate chips! They have sugar and thats off limits. You can definitely have sweet things though (in moderation). One of my favorites are the cream cheese muffins. Be sure to exercise portion control though! Good luck! Google atkins dessert recipes, there are lots and lots of them!
2- 8oz. pkgs Philadelphia Cream Cheese
1/2 cup sweetener
2 eggs
1/2 tsp. vanilla
Soften cream cheese about 40 seconds in microwave. Add other ingredients. Beat with mixer till smooth. Pour into 12 muffin pans lined with the papers. Bake at 350 for 20 min.
These are like a mini-cheesecake. I use sugar free davinci syrup in them instead of the granular splenda (saves carbs) They turn out wonderful! They tend to fall a little in the middle and are much much better chilled

Don't step off the plan this early in the game. Making it through a clean Induction is a goal in itself and if you do it successfully, the change in tastes and the detox provided by Induction sets you up in a much better state of mind and state of body to continue successfully. Your body is missing the sweets and is trying to trick you into giving up. Don't let it. Hang in there, it will be worth it.

Remember even though the carb count may be within your limits, if it has sugar, it is poison to this diet. (Added sugar that is as opposed to the natural sugars in most foods).
After severly limiting even artificial sweetners, I find that when I do eat something sweet such as sugarfree gum, it is overly sweet to me now.
Also when you get to the fruit rung, you will find a sweet pleasure in strawberries and blueberries, you never noticed before. It is amazing how much sweeter the allowed things are after cutting back.
When I want something sweet I can't eat I opt for olices or cream cheese. These kill the urge tremendously.
